How they compare
ECLAC: Carribean (unsdcode:98301) currently reports 3,217 against 37 in Algeria, a difference of 3,180.
That makes ECLAC: Carribean (unsdcode:98301)'s figure about 86.9 times Algeria's.
Across all 12 years both countries report, ECLAC: Carribean (unsdcode:98301) has been ahead every year.
Algeria ranks 85th and ECLAC: Carribean (unsdcode:98301) ranks 85th of 235 countries.
ECLAC: Carribean (unsdcode:98301) has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
